效果图:
activity的布局xml:
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
andro...
分类:
移动平台 时间:
2015-08-12 13:22:41
收藏:
0 评论:
0 赞:
0 阅读:
309
MVC4使用Devexpress Report建立主从报表实现效果如下:
其实Dev的功能非常强大,只需要知道方法后,我们可以很方便的进行操作!以上的功能只需要拖控件,设置属性即可!
1、建立MVC4网站项目
2、在项目中添加Report文件夹,也可以直接将报表建立在View文件夹下
3、在添加报表之前,先建立好需要使用的实体对象,方便在建立报表时候进行引用;建立ClassModel和Stu...
分类:
其他 时间:
2015-08-12 13:22:31
收藏:
0 评论:
0 赞:
0 阅读:
446
注意到一个很重要的性质:每次添加的线段必定比前面添加的线段长。
所以可以用 左端点>=当前线段左端点的线段数 - 右端点>当前线段右端点的线段数,就是答案。
Segment Game
Time Limit: 3000/1500 MS (Java/Others) Memory Limit: 65536/65536 K (Java/Others)
Total Submissio...
分类:
其他 时间:
2015-08-12 13:22:21
收藏:
0 评论:
0 赞:
0 阅读:
194
Activity之间使用Parcel传递大量数据产生的问题。
Activity之间通过intent传递大量数据,导致新Activity无法启动。
Activity之间数据传递方式总结参考 这 里。
比较常用的是直接利用intent传递,比如使用bundle,如下:
Intent intent =new Intent(ActivityA.this,ActivityB.class)...
分类:
其他 时间:
2015-08-12 13:22:11
收藏:
0 评论:
0 赞:
0 阅读:
231
不得不说,这是一题非常经典的体积并。。然而还是debug了2个多小时...
首先思路:按z的大小排序。
然后相当于扫描面一样,,从体积的最下方向上方扫描,遇到这个面
就将对应的两条线加入到set中,或者从set中删除,然后再对set中的所有边,求一次面积并
由于最后求出来的是至少有3个体积叠加的部分的体积。
所以需要维护3个节点,然后push_up会稍微啰嗦一点...
...
分类:
其他 时间:
2015-08-12 13:22:01
收藏:
0 评论:
0 赞:
0 阅读:
226
原因:
android以前可以通过AIDL进行静默接听,但是5.0以后就被谷歌给屏蔽了,这时候我们只能通过其他方式实现了。
解决方案:
try {
Runtime.getRuntime().exec("input keyevent " +
Integer.toString(KeyEvent.KEYCODE_HEADSETHOOK...
分类:
移动平台 时间:
2015-08-12 13:21:51
收藏:
0 评论:
0 赞:
0 阅读:
751
RequiredFieldValidator控件验证不能为空时报错多种解决方法以及问题分析...
分类:
其他 时间:
2015-08-12 13:21:41
收藏:
0 评论:
0 赞:
0 阅读:
241
欢迎参加——每周六晚的BestCoder(有米!)
Necklace
Time Limit: 15000/5000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 4003 Accepted Submission(s): 1330
Pr...
分类:
其他 时间:
2015-08-12 13:21:31
收藏:
0 评论:
0 赞:
0 阅读:
179
题目大意:
给一个整数N,求1~N中与N互质的数的4次方的和。
解题思路:
题目简单,过程有点复杂。理清思路就简单了。
利用公式1^4 + 2^4 + … + n^4 = n*(n+1)*(2*n+1)*(3*n^2+3*n-1)/30,可以求出
1^4 + 2^4 + … + n^4,除以30可以先求出30模M的逆元,然后将上式中除以30改为
乘以30的逆元。
再来求与n不互质的数的4次方和。将n质因数分解为 n = p1^a1* p2^a2 * … * pn^an
(其中p1、p2为质数)。
这样不互...
分类:
其他 时间:
2015-08-12 13:21:21
收藏:
0 评论:
0 赞:
0 阅读:
121
无标题文档
function validateForm()
{
var username = document.forms["myForm"]["username"].value;
var password = document.forms["myForm"]["password"].value;
alert(username+" "+password);
}...
分类:
编程语言 时间:
2015-08-12 13:21:11
收藏:
0 评论:
0 赞:
0 阅读:
148
一、为什么要设置IP欺骗1、 当某个IP的访问过于频繁,或者访问量过大时,服务器会拒绝访问请求,这时候通过IP欺骗可以增加访问频率和访问量,以达到压力测试的效果。2、 某些服务器配置了负载均衡,使用同一个IP不能测出系统的实际性能。LR中的IP欺骗通过调用不同的IP,可很大程度上的模拟实际使用中多IP访问和测试服务器均衡处理的能力。二、IP欺骗设置方法l 在配置前首先要确定本地IP是固定的,不能是...
分类:
其他 时间:
2015-08-12 13:21:01
收藏:
0 评论:
0 赞:
0 阅读:
245
思路:
先写好了几个函数。旋转,四种操作,判断是否可以进行合并消除
题中有好几处要考虑的细节问题,如
自然下落到底部时不进行合并的判断,而是当自然下落非法时才判断
如果消除一行,这一行上面的所以方块只会下落一行,不存在直接下落到底部的情况
比赛时题意没有理解好,错了这两个地方。。
还有一些写法上的错误,这种左右移动的题目坐标还是要从1开始,方便许多
左右移动,如果非法要复原的...
分类:
其他 时间:
2015-08-12 13:20:41
收藏:
0 评论:
0 赞:
0 阅读:
129
android中canvas的clipRect和concate调用顺序不同导致的图像效果不同。...
分类:
移动平台 时间:
2015-08-12 13:20:31
收藏:
0 评论:
0 赞:
0 阅读:
265
由于安卓手机底层就是linux内核,因此在linux(比如debian/ubuntu)下usb连接电脑连接手机更加方便。
首次使用usb连接电脑时会弹出Xiaomi文件磁盘,里面是windows下的安装控制文件,linux下基本上说可以是没用的。本文将给出linux系统下挂载小米手机方法:
方法一:
1.将手机连接至PC机
2.如果是第一次使用MTP设备需要安装以下软件,否则...
分类:
移动平台 时间:
2015-08-12 13:20:21
收藏:
0 评论:
0 赞:
0 阅读:
1663
对C++里面的多维数组进行操作 int arr[2][3] = { { 1, 2, 3 }, { 4, 5, 6 } };
int * p1 = (int *)(arr + 1);
cout << p1[0] << endl;
int * p2 = (int *)(&arr + 1);
cout << p2[-1] << endl;
cout << ar...
分类:
编程语言 时间:
2015-08-12 13:20:11
收藏:
0 评论:
0 赞:
0 阅读:
240
A flexible and scalable slam system with full 3d motion estimation 论文学习记录
这篇论文系统框架,栅格多阈值,更新同步与伪数据,扫描匹配起始点,协方差交叉融合的思想还是值得借鉴的。
摘要
关注于搜救机器人建图定位与导航的框架性文章。 低计算资源的在线快速获取栅格地图; 结合鲁棒的激光扫描匹配方法和惯性传感器姿态估计系统。
快速地图梯度近似与多分辨率(类似图像金字塔)栅格地图,精确而不需要闭环检测。...
分类:
其他 时间:
2015-08-12 13:20:01
收藏:
0 评论:
0 赞:
0 阅读:
612
1. DPI(dot per inch):
DPI是鼠标移动每英寸时汇报给系统的点数。
2. CPI:
CPI是鼠标移动1英寸时向系统发出的移动信号的数量。
3. MouseSpeed, MouseThreshold1 和 MouseThreshold2:
MouseSpeed决定当鼠标移动时,光标应该以多快的速度(pixel的数量)移动以与之对应。这三个参数共同决定...
分类:
其他 时间:
2015-08-12 13:19:51
收藏:
0 评论:
0 赞:
0 阅读:
156
在测试App的过程中,Activity调用了isDestroyed()方法,报出了java.lang.NoSuchMethodError错误。
自己手机MI 2S,版本4.1.1。
其实原因就是isDestroyed()这个方法是在4.2引入的,所以在4.1.1上调用此方法会报错。
需要做一下版本的判断了,Build.VERSION.SDK_INT
那么问题来了,如何判断某个函数...
分类:
编程语言 时间:
2015-08-12 13:19:41
收藏:
0 评论:
0 赞:
0 阅读:
3978
题目描述:
多个镇里面有n个人在选镇长,在每一个村里面选择一个所有村名(1…n标记)都认识的人,(这个人可以不认识所有人),如果有多个人则同时列出来。#include
#include
using namespace std;struct Node
{
int index;
Node *next;
Node(int d =...
分类:
其他 时间:
2015-08-12 13:19:31
收藏:
0 评论:
0 赞:
0 阅读:
236
HDFS原理
HDFS(Hadoop Distributed File System)是一个分布式文件系统,是谷歌的GFS山寨版本。它具有高容错性并提供了高吞吐量的数据访问,非常适合大规模数据集上的应用,它提供了一个高度容错性和高吞吐量的海量数据存储解决方案。
高吞吐量访问:HDFS的每个Block分布在不同的Rack上,在用户访问时,HDFS会计算使用最近和访问量最小的服务器给用户提...
分类:
其他 时间:
2015-08-12 13:19:21
收藏:
0 评论:
0 赞:
0 阅读:
199